News anchor Curt Menefee is leaving Fox 5’s “Good Day New York,” where he has been a co-host alongside longtime anchor Rosanna Scotto for nearly two years.
“January will be two years since I’ve been doing ‘Good Day New York,’ but I’m not coming back in 2026,” Menefee said during the show on Tuesday morning.
His last day in the anchor seat at “Good Day New York” was set for Dec. 19.

Menefee will continue his role as the host of Fox NFL Sunday, along with hosting special sporting events like the Belmont Stakes and US Open Golf.
He has been at Fox Sports since 1997, starting as a sideline reporter and later serving as a play-by-play announcer for the network’s NFL, USFL and NFL Europe coverage.
